Busta Rhymes, Chris Cornell Join Projekt Revolution Tour
Linkin Park's fifth annual Projekt Revolution tour has rounded up Busta Rhymes, Chris Cornell, 10 Years, Armor For Sleep, Ashes Divide, Atreyu, Hawthorne Heights, Street Drum Corps, and the Bravery. Set to kick off on July 16 in Mansfield, MA, the amphitheater-heavy trek will wind down on August 24 in Woodlands, TX.Interestingly enough, Linkin Park co-frontman Mike Shinoda said the tour wouldn't have any hip-hop artists this year in an April interview with LiveDaily. He explained, "I think maybe in the future we'll have some more hip-hop artists back on the bill, but last year and this year we didn't find the right rap groups to put on the show. There weren’t any that we felt would mix well with everything. And I think, for this one, it's pretty much an all-rock bill and there's a ton of variety this year. I think this is a really diverse bill, as far as rock goes."
Busta Rhymes latest disc, Blessed, was originally set for last December and is now expected on July 1. The effort features Kanye West, Timbaland, RZA, Mary J. Blige, Common, Akon, and more.
